Yum! Summer picked Sushi Roku for her Vegas birthday celebration dinner and I'm so happy that she did! The six of us were seated at an awesome round table with a super view of the Las Vegas strip.
We started with a large order of sake-bombing materials (two of the six were sake-bombing virgins!) and a couple of the signature cocktails. I tried the lycee mojito which was good but not lycee-y enough and the other girls loved the tropical peach passion and lycee martini.
We ordered a wide variety of dishes to share and for personal consumption. I liked the crispy chicken appetizer with yummy dipping sauce and the spicy tuna and california rolls. I usually love eel sushi but our eel was overly fishy. Summer tried a signature roll with tuna, cilantro, and more which was yummy though wasabi-infused and spicy! The salty edaname were also very good and Rachel couldn't stop raving about the sea bass main dish.
Our sweet waitress gave us a complimentary birthday sake jug and a fun mini-birthday celebration of molten chocolate cake and a crazy sparkler. For about $65 each, we all left satiated and ready to party!
